Lovely country villa in a fabulous location on the edge of the beautiful nature reserve of Torre guaceto and just minutes form its miles of sandy beaches.



Electric gates lead to  the private driveway flanked on either side by lush colourful Oleander. The villa of approximately 160 sq m   is very spacious with a large modern open plan kitchen and living room. A corridor leads to the three double bedrooms, two of which have ensuite bathrooms.There is also a main family bathroom. Under the kitchen is a cool cantina ideal for wine and olive oil  storage. Double doors lead from the living room out to the shady veranda which surrounds two sides of the house providing lots of space for outdoor dining and relaxing. To one side of the veranda you have a laundry room and stairs to the roof. The roof terrace enjoys spectacular views over the nature reserve all the way to the sea. This would be the perfect place to add a roof top gazebo for sundowners with a view.



A few metres from the house there is a separate garage with plumbing and electrics, large enough for two cars or to be converted into more accommodation. The garden of about 3000 sqm which surrounds the house is fully fenced.The remaining land is all olive grove  with 500 trees producing a wonderful harvest of olive oil .



The train line passes a few hundred metres from the property but trains are not frequent and do not take anything from the tranquility of the area.

The Area



Just a stones throw from the villa you will find  the beaches of Torre Guaceto. In an often crowded Salento, Torre Guaceto remains an oasis of peace and tranquility. Despite its incredible beauty, this beach remains surprisingly uncrowded compared to other locations in Puglia.Nature lovers will find a true paradise on earth at Torre Guaceto. The crystal-clear water that laps its shores invites swimming and snorkeling, providing an experience of direct contact with marine life. Along the coast you will also find the gorgeous sea side  villages of Santa Sabina and Specchiolla, full of seafront restaurants and beach clubs.

The lovely town of Carovigno, just 12 km away, boasts many excellent restaurants from local trattorie to Michelin star. A beautiful piazza and centro storico, complete with a Norman castle, is perfect for an evening passeggiata!

The beautiful città bianca Ostuni is only 17 km from the property. Ostuni is a buzzy tourist town full of restaurants and bars with always something happening.

The sea outside Porto Cesareo, further up the coast, is probably the most beautiful and fantastic sunset.GETTING THERE:

By air, there is a choice of two international airports, served by Ryanair, Easyjet, Ba and others, both easily reached: Bari in the north by car on the motorway in approximately 1 hour 20minutes and nearby Brindisi in the south in about 20 minutes.

There is a train station at Brindisi, and it is possible to take the train from Bari airport via Bari Central in 1 hour and 25 minutes.



MORE To See In APULIA:

Bari, the commercial capital city with 250 000 inhabitants, offers the best shopping, a grand opera house called the Petruzzelli teatro, and a large medical city centre with many museums. Just north of Bari lies a little town called Giovinazzo, a true gem right by the sea. Further north is Molfetta Outlet, a famous shopping galleria and 20 minutes further is Traini, a sophisticated town with a beautiful half-moon bay & marina. Continue north to Castel del Monte, the mystical castle Frederic Ii built in the 13th Century.

Within a 2,5 hour drive to the North of Bari lies Gargano, the peninsula called the spur of the Italian boot. Gargano forms a significant nature and wildlife Reserve and offers hiking and scenic trips around the peninsula. From here, there are daily boat trips to the small Tremiti islands.

SPORTS:

As Apulia is a peninsula surrounded by two seas- the Adriatic in the north and the Ionic in the south  water sports dominate in the area: sailing, yachting, water skiing, kite-surfing, swimming & beach life. Scuba diving and fishing are available in Santa Sabina. Torre Guaceto nature reserve also extends to the sea, so the coastline presents a heaven of sea life, ideal for snorkelling.

Golf has five good courses, and San Domenico is world class (Pga 2014 Challenge Final). Tennis, horseback riding, hiking and bicycle tours are other options for the active-minded. Squash clubs are located in Bari, Bitonto and other places.



THE WEATHER:

Southern Italy is warm and friendly, and the temperature in Serra Nova is temperate all year round. Even in the cold of January, it doesnt drop much below 15c. Serra Nova has a microclimate.

The temperature in Apulia is very temperate. May, June, July, and September tend to be 25 to 30 March, April and October in the 20c. The summer months can get to 40c, ideal for those sun lovers.



Winter temperatures Nov, Dec, Jan, Feb. Range from 8c to 15c, depending on the sun. We have had weeks of endless sunshine during the Winter. Places like Ostuni, Fasano and Cisternino are very hilly and can even have occasional snowfalls. The temperature can differ between these cities by 10c.



Being south, Apulia has warmer weather than Northern Italy. Even in the winter months of December to February, the average number of sun hours per day is four and 10-11 sun hours per day in June-August! This means you can enjoy a long season of nice weather in Apulia. When you plan to buy a holiday home in Apulia, think that you will spend a lot more time outside than on the inside compared to at home. Therefore, you will need plenty of terrace space, pergolas etc., at your Apulian property and also, cooking facilities outdoors are convenient.



The water temperature at the beginning of May is, on average, 19 degrees, up to 27 degrees in August/September and 19 degrees in November. This means you & family will spend time at the beach. Where ever you are in Apulia, you can reach the shores within 30 minutes.
